Produktbeschreibung
Evidence based prevention strategies rely on the modification of lifestyle habits such as smoking cessation, exercising and following a low fat diet. This is what I assumed until a few years ago when I was made aware of concepts such as orthomolecular nutrition and functional medicine. I then realized that we doctors must open our minds and look for atypical risk factors and understand the body as an agglutinate of billions of cells, not a machine formed by organs working separately. We open narrowed arteries with stents or bypass grafts, with no interest in a systemic aproach. The higher the use of statins and the lower the cholesterol levels in our current society, the higher the incidence of ischemic heart disease and stroke. It is not solely due to our aging population, because it is evident that atherosclerosis is manifesting at earlier ages than ever before. This book is an invitation to think differently. We must not admit that prevention strategies fail. We should re-learn the anatomy and the physiology of the body thinking in terms of cells and metabolic interactions.
